HOW CUSTOM WORK STARTS
The right brief saves a round of sampling
Two bags can share the same dimensions and still behave very differently. One may need a soft zipper for repeated opening. Another needs a destructive seal for shipping. A garment bag has to release trapped air. A bag for a polished electronic part has to avoid scuffing the surface.
Send the item size, weight, packing method, target quantity and destination market first. Material names can come later if your team has not chosen one.

MATERIAL CUSTOMIZATION
Choose material after the use conditions are clear
Protection, appearance, print method, disposal route and regulatory scope all affect the choice. We record the approved structure in the product specification.

Biodegradable film
For projects that need a compostability route and clear disposal wording. Exact resin, additives, ink and certificate coverage must be checked together.

Plant fiber
A soft, breathable option for garments and selected dry goods. Surface feel, tear strength and moisture exposure need sample testing.

Paper and glassine
Useful when a paper-led presentation matters. Confirm transparency, fold behavior, seal method and the source of certified paper.

Recycled plastic
PCR film can suit repeat, high-volume programs where toughness and familiar packing performance matter. Recycled-content evidence depends on the supply chain and scope.
BAG STYLE CUSTOMIZATION
Pick the opening and closure your customer will use
The bag style controls packing speed, reseal use, display and tamper evidence. We can adjust dimensions, flap depth, zipper position, hanging details and print area.

Flat bags
A simple format for parts, apparel, stationery and inner packing. Available with open top, heat seal or a separate closure requirement.

Press-to-close bags
A reusable profile for small electronics, accessories and kits. Profile strength and usable internal space should be checked with the real product.

Zipper bags
Easy opening for apparel, care products and retail sets. Options can include slider, soft zipper, hanger hole and ventilation.

Self-adhesive bags
Fast closure for garment packing and fulfillment. Choose resealable adhesive or a destructive seal according to the sales and return process.

Drawstring bags
A flexible format for footwear, gifts, home goods and reusable storage. Cord material, channel strength and load need to match the packed item.
WHAT CAN BE CUSTOMIZED
Put every approval point in one specification
Small details cause most repeat-order disputes. A signed drawing and reference sample give purchasing, production and inspection the same target.
Bag size
State whether the dimensions are internal or external. Record width, length, gusset, flap, closure position and opening. The drawing should also show the permitted tolerance and the packed-product clearance.
Approval point Signed drawing and fit test with the real item
Film or paper thickness
Use a clear unit such as microns, millimetres or mil. Confirm whether the value refers to one wall or the total bag, then agree the tolerance and measurement method.
Approval point Nominal thickness, tolerance and physical sample
Packaging material
Choose PLA and PBAT compostable film, plant fiber, recyclable or PCR plastic, or paper-based material according to protection, appearance, disposal route and the destination market.
Approval point Approved material structure, sample and applicable documents
Color and printing
Define clear, translucent, opaque, frosted or a custom base color, then confirm print sides, ink colors, coverage and artwork version. Include white backing, warning copy, barcode and QR code requirements where needed.
Approval point Material color sample, signed artwork and readable codes
Perforation and holes
Distinguish ventilation holes, micro-perforation, tear perforation, hanger holes and handle cut-outs. Record the size, count and position, then check that the change does not weaken the loaded bag.
Approval point Hole drawing and load or tear check
Certification alignment
Match the final material, ink, adhesive, zipper and other components to the certificate or report. Confirm the holder, scope, validity, destination market and permitted wording before artwork approval.
Approval point Document matrix linked to the final specification

BEFORE MASS PRODUCTION
Six checks before approving custom packaging bags
A quotation can be commercially correct and still leave technical details open. Close these points before the purchase order and sample approval become the production reference.
- 01
Measure the packed product
Do not copy an old bag size without checking the current item. Confirm the usable internal space, insertion clearance and whether the dimensions include the flap or closure.
- 02
Separate performance from the environmental claim
The bag still has to seal, carry the load and survive storage. Confirm those needs before selecting compostable, recycled, recyclable or paper-based material.
- 03
Control units and file versions
Use one drawing with clear units, tolerances and revision number. Link it to the current artwork, quotation and approved sample.
- 04
Approve every printed statement
The buyer should confirm brand copy, warnings, disposal instructions, barcodes and certification marks for the destination market before plates or cylinders are made.
- 05
Test the sample in real use
Pack the actual product. Open, close, scan, stack and place it in the shipping carton. A visual review alone may miss a tight opening or weak seal.
- 06
Write the inspection standard
Agree the dimensions, appearance limits, print checks, closure tests, packing count and sampling method that will be used before shipment.
CERTIFICATION AND TEST DOCUMENTS
Confirm the scope before printing a claim
A standard, report, certification mark and chain-of-custody certificate do different jobs. Ask for the file that matches the final material, finished bag, certificate holder and sales market.

| Route | What the buyer should check |
|---|---|
| TÜV Austria OK compost INDUSTRIAL | Certification scheme, EN 13432 test basis, product scope and mark-use rules |
| TÜV Austria OK compost HOME | Certificate holder, grade or product covered, components and validity |
| DIN CERTCO | The applicable certification scheme and EN 13432 evidence. “DIN 6400” should not be used as a substitute for an exact certificate reference |
| GRS | Recycled-content scope, certified organization and chain-of-custody records |
| FSC | Paper source, license code, product group and trademark approval |
| BPI | Certified item listing and the applicable ASTM D6400 or D6868 route |
| AS 4736 | Australian commercial composting scope and finished-product coverage |
| Document | Use in a packaging project |
|---|---|
| REACH | Restricted-substance information for the supplied materials and relevant articles |
| RoHS | Relevant mainly when packaging is specified within an electrical or electronic product compliance program |
| AS 4736 | A compostability standard, not a general product-safety certificate. Check it under the environmental claim route |

Are all custom bags covered by the same environmental certification?
No. Certification applies to a defined material or product, certificate holder and test scope. Match the applicable file to the final construction and destination market.
What can be checked during packaging bag inspection?
The agreed inspection plan may cover dimensions, thickness, appearance, print position and color, closure operation, seal strength, barcode readability, packing count and carton marks.

What should be confirmed for a recyclable poly bag?
Confirm the polymer family, mono-material target, recycled-content requirement, closures, inks, labels and additives, collection route, destination-market claim and the evidence needed to support recyclability or recycled content.
What should be approved before custom packaging bag production?
Approve one revision-controlled set containing the bag drawing, dimensions and tolerances, material structure, artwork, printed claims, physical sample, inspection standard, packing method and required documents.
